Increase Blog Traffic - 3 Simple Tips

I must say how to increase blog traffic is one of the most common questions asked by a lot of people but are they doing anything about it? Do they know what to do to increase it? You cannot simply complain about not having enough blog traffic because you have not done anything to increase it.

Ask yourself these questions first:

Do you have good content on your website or blog?

This is one of the major factor that even I myself are facing. It's not easy to come out with good content if you are someone who don't like writing. The simple solution is to get ghost writers to write those articles for you but you have to fork out the money. Another solution is, depending on your website or blog theme, search the top 10 websites, take down notes and summarise it and write an article about it. Make it a point to produce 2 quality articles a day and in one month you will have 60 articles. Eventually you will have a content rich blog or website. It takes time but it can be done. 2 articles is not that difficult. Even if you do have good content, you still need to make it known.

Are you writing according to market demand?

A lot of people simply fire up their blog and start writing without giving this a thought. Are you writing for yourself only or you are hoping that someone will want to read as well? If you are writing for someone, you must make sure that someone can find your article. The purpose of doing search engine optimisation is for long term traffic. You can't expect immediate traffic. If you want immediate traffic, using Pay per click is one of the fastest.

Have you make it known?

After you have done it, submit them to blog directories and article directories like Ezine. Submit also to Web 2.0 websites like facebook, digg, stumbleupon, technorati, squidoo etc... You will soon get increased web traffic but whether it will be consistent will depend on the quality of your content, whether it will attract your readers or visitors to come back again.

Start asking yourself these 3 questions and if you can answer it, I can be sure you will get the increased blog traffic you want.
